Indiana, particularly within the significant population centers of Indianapolis and Fort Wayne, experiences a continental climate characterized by distinct seasons that heavily influence HVAC demands. The extended, frigid winters necessitate reliable furnace operation for consistent indoor comfort, while the warm, humid summers require efficient air conditioning. This climatic duality means that robust and well-maintained furnace systems are a year-round necessity for Hoosier homeowners.

The housing stock in Indiana, ranging from historic farmhouses to contemporary suburban developments, presents varied challenges for furnace repair and maintenance. Older homes may feature less efficient ductwork or insulation, requiring technicians to consider airflow dynamics and potential thermal bridging during their assessments. Indiana's building codes, while adhering to national standards, may have specific mandates regarding combustion air provisions and flue pipe installations for furnaces, emphasizing the need for contractors to be intimately familiar with state and local regulations to ensure safety and compliance.

When a furnace fails in Indiana, especially during the critical winter months, swift and precise service is paramount. The cold can quickly lead to discomfort and potential damage to plumbing if temperatures drop too low. Providers in Indiana must be adept at diagnosing issues common to furnaces operating in prolonged cold, such as thermocouple failures or cracked heat exchangers. What is the $5000 rule for AC in Indiana?

The ' $5000 rule' for AC systems in Indiana is not a formal regulation but rather a financial benchmark. It suggests that if the cost of repairing an existing AC unit approaches $5000, it may be more economically sensible to invest in a new system. A professional HVAC technician can help you evaluate this decision.
